Transaction cdb64a86ef267bb5848b3b6e4307395915665c5330aa1e5d5dc366a9d974f680

block
b85de41f1eec65eda85cc20bfc9df6698ed5c5630a295031f24142ff1784d293

1 Input

23 Outputs